Virgin Voyages’ Resilient Lady Completes Her Final Sea Trial returning safely to Fincantieri’s Sestri Shipyard in Genoa

Resilient Lady, has successfully completed her final sea trial, returning safely to Sestri Shipyard in Genoa, Italy. During the speed trial, she reached an impressive speed of 23 knots (26.5 mph or 42.6 km/h).

“We’re continuing to work closely with the Fincantieri team to get Resilient Lady ready before her debut in August out of Athens. Together, our marine teams are testing her safety systems, automation, power generation and propulsion systems,”, says Virgin Voyages.

Once Resilient Lady hits the waters on August 14, she’ll sail the following seven-night itineraries:
Adriatic Sea & Greek Gems – Piraeus (Athens), Dubrovnik, Kotor, Corfu, Argostoli, Piraeus (Athens)
Greek Island Glow – Piraeus (Athens), Santorini, Rhodes, Chania (Souda Bay), Mykonos Piraeus (Athens)

Resilient Lady will also embark on one, nine-night journey before doing an 11-night trans-Atlantic voyage from Portugal to Puerto Rico.

Charming Greece, Italy, Spain and Portugal – Piraeus (Athens), Catania, Palma de Mallorca, Málaga, Lisbon
Transatlantic Portugal to Puerto Rico – Lisbon, Funchal, Gran Canaria, Santa Cruz de Tenerife, San Juan

Once in the Caribbean this winter, Resilient Lady will be based out of San Juan and stop at some of the most irresistible Caribbean ports of call:

Southeastern Caribbean Isles – San Juan, Tortola, Pointe-à-Pitre, Bridgetown, Castries, St. John’s, San Juan
Sunsets in the Lesser Antilles – San Juan, Oranjestad, Willemstad, Fort-de-France, Basseterre, San Juan
